Transaction 78afdbc2a28ed11af33b1170299e51d344a553143b4e43a5326f25611d5566c2

1 Input
1 Outputs
  • 78afdbc2a28ed11af33b1170299e51d344a553143b4e43a5326f25611d5566c2:0
  • value  15432740
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z